Post subject: | Alienbee 800 Not Firing |
I just unboxed a brand new Alienbee 800. I assembled per the instructions and the red test button does not trigger the flash. Furthermore, the CyberSync does not fir the flash. When I unplug the telephone jack from the back of the flash unit, the flash triggers. It also triggers when I plug the telephone cable back into the unit. When I unplug the flash unit from the cybersync unit it will fire in slave mode when another light is triggered. I purchased three of these lights. Two work and are triggered just fine by the test button on the back and by the Cyber Commander. This other seems DOA. Any recommendations? |

Post subject: | Re: Alienbee 800 Not Firing |
Are you using a Cyber Commander? If not, you should not be using the RJ11 telephone cord, rather you should be using the 1/8 to 1/8 cable. If you are using a CC, it sounds like the light is performing properly, but there is a setting that is keeping it from firing. Make sure the power slider on the light is set to FULL. Make sure you have a vertical (blue) bar on the Cyber Commander that correlates to the channel of this reciever. Make sure the Cyber Commander is set to a channel, or ALL, and not a group (GRP). Once everything is fully set up, fire the lights from the ALL setting on the Cyber Commander. |
